2006 New York Code - Power Of Supreme Court Justices In Rockland County To Appoint Law Stenographers And Typists.



 
    § 165-b. Power of supreme court justices in Rockland county to appoint
  law  stenographers  and typists.  The justice or justices of the supreme
  court residing in Rockland county, or a majority of  them,  may  appoint
  and  at  pleasure  remove and prescribe the duties of a confidential law
  stenographer and typist, who shall receive such compensation as  may  be
  fixed  by  the  board  of  supervisors of such county. Such compensation
  shall be a charge against such county and shall be paid by the treasurer
  thereof in monthly installments upon the certificate of such justice  or
  justices, or a majority of them.
